Amity Strikes

The show that I loved for so long and that I will keep loving even longer is over. The final episode of the final season aired on Easter Monday. I’m still holding a grudge that Disney shortened season 3 to three extended episodes of ca. 45 minutes each. I loved season 3 too, but I feel robbed of what could have been. Plus, unluckily, the shortening shows in the episodes at some point or the other. However, this won’t lessen my admiration for the season, for the show, for Dana and Co and everything they had achieved.

And especially the ending sequence of the final episode is everything we fans could’ve wished for. In particular I love Amity’s design in the end of the episode (I don’t consider it a spoiler anymore). The hairstyle, the clothes, everything is amazing. Therefore, I had to draw her doing what she does best: Hovering around abomination goo.

First, I drew an overall painting of her, the goo in full size. Then, I realized, it put away the focus from Amity, it weakened the impression I’d liked to create with this painting. So, I cropped the painting, zoomed in, if you like, focussing on Amity, only parts of the goo in the frame of the picture and made it the main version (you will find the other version in the second slide).

Recently, a redraw challenge based on the newest Barbie movie trailer was going round on Instagram. I immediately got the idea to participate by drawing my Arcryla City OCs Crissy and Paula.

I don’t know what they were charged with (probably wine theft or overspeeding – probably both), but at least Paula seems to have fun.

When I first shared this painting, there was a mistake that I only noticed afterwards. Having the height scale in the background, I wanted to show their height difference once more. Crissy is taller than Paula although Paula often wears high heels and/or platform boots. Assuming, she was told to take them of for the shot, the scale was supposed to show the correct height difference.

Unluckily, I drew Crissy one inch too small. Therefore I edited it and now it’s really finalized.
